Tradewind Finance Expands Footprint in Mexico with Two New Additions to the Americas Team

Tradewind Finance, an international trade finance firm specializing in cash flow solutions that enable business growth and seamless cross-border trade, is expanding its footprint in Mexico with two new hires. The company’s growing team in the region comes at a time when Mexico has become a major trading partner for countries including the United States, making trade finance an attractive tool for facilitating export and import transactions.

Rafael Marin Mattozzi joins the Tradewind Americas sales team as an International Factoring Consultant. He brings years of experience serving in account management roles in Spain as well as a deep know-how of the banking and financial sector through his positions at Banco Santander, American Express, Banco Afirme and BIX Consultores in Mexico. Rafael received his Bachelor’s degree in Communications from St. Thomas University, Miami and a Master’s degree in Marketing and Sales from CEREM in Madrid.

Cecilia Leon Gastelum, also a newly appointed International Factoring Consultant for the Americas sales team, has vast experience in both the public and private sectors. She began her career as part of the Corporate Banking team at BBVA, the biggest bank in Mexico. Afterwards, she received an invitation to join Nacional Financiera (NAFIN), one of the largest Mexican development banks where she helped companies from a financial and social perspective, supporting SMEs to become more institutionalized. Her latest role was at Stenn, a fintech focused on offering global trade finance solutions. Cecilia is a graduate of Tec de Monterrey in Mexico where she received her Bachelor’s degree in Financial Management.

Both Rafael and Cecilia report to Brian Dowd, Senior Vice President in the firm’s New York office. In addition to their focus on business development in Mexico, they will oversee opportunities for financing businesses located in Central and South America.

出口企业融资指南:出口发票保理与出口发票贴现

受益于新时代的非银金融公司和银行提供的便捷金融援助,全球中小微企业正在攀登通往成功的阶梯。 金融援助旨在帮助企业优化现金流,应对市场波动和其他挑战,并抓住每一个发展机遇,在竞争激烈的行业中蓬勃发展。在出口领域中,当今推动中小微企业发展的两个最重要的融资工具是出口发票保理和出口发票贴现。外贸企业可以通过这些关键辅助工具,为应对财务挑战做好充分准备。 对于需要即时财务解决方案以优化现金流的外贸企业,出口发票保理和出口发票贴现都有多种优势。然而,企业在选择时往往面临困境,因为二者有相似之处;例如,这两种融资方式都利用发票来提高流动性。 熟悉出口发票保理和出口发票贴现之间的区别,有助于出口企业根据自身财务状况、信用记录和即时需求做出明智决策。在决定融资方案之前,了解每种方案的具体目的以及它们之间的区别非常重要。本文我们将探讨出口发票保理和出口发票贴现之间的主要区别。 出口发票保理与出口发票贴现的主要区别 在深入探讨二者区别之前,让我们先从贸易融资中的出口发票保理开始,仔细研究这两种融资方式。出口发票保理又称出口应收账款保理,是一种融资安排,即企业将未结清的发票出售给第三方国际保理公司。 作为回报,出口企业能立即收到现金,通常是发票价值的70%-90%,并在海外客户付款之后获得剩余金额(扣除费用)。出口保理公司负责在发票到期时向客户收款。这种方法可以帮助出口企业弥补因延迟付款造成的现金流缺口,满足即时财务需求。 出口发票贴现同样是一种融资安排,出口企业将发票作为抵押品,获得短期贷款,之后必须偿还。在出口发票融资安排中,金融中介机构会预付发票金额的大部分(高达95%)。当海外买家在发票到期时付款,企业再向融资方付款。 出口发票保理和出口发票贴现的主要区别在于收款流程。在出口发票保理业务中,出口保理公司负责收款。这涉及核实发票、信用控制和债务追偿等任务。这使企业能专注于创收而非行政管理任务。在出口发票贴现中,出口企业必须负责收款,与客户维持良好关系,同时确保改善现金流。 就资格而言,出口发票保理业务是中小企业(包括信用记录有限的企业)更为理想的解决方案。出口保理公司的决策主要基于出口商海外买家的信誉度,因为他们才是付款方。发票贴现则适用于有经常性发票且需要大量资金的企业。 另一个重要区别与保密程度有关。在出口发票保理业务中,海外买家知道出口保理公司参与了付款过程。这种透明度并不总是有利于出口商,因为它可能引起客户对出口商财务稳定性的担忧。 而出口发票贴现是一种保密安排,客户不知道外贸企业与贷款人之间的财务安排。这对于优先考虑与客户保持稳固关系的企业而言是一种优势。

福费廷是什么?福费廷在国际贸易中的十大好处

国际贸易融资行业为企业提供了全球扩张的机会。对各行各业而言,这些增长机会也伴随着一系列挑战。在参与国际贸易时,外贸企业往往面临与付款条件、信用风险和现金流管理相关的复杂问题。 这正是福费廷业务发挥重要作用之处。它是一种金融工具,能为参与国际贸易的企业带来一系列好处。从更好地降低信用风险,到进入全球市场并实现竞争优势,福费廷在支持出口增长和改善金融稳定性方面发挥着关键作用。 福费廷是什么? 福费廷(Forfaiting)是一种国际贸易融资方式,主要用于出口商的应收账款融资。其特点是出口商将未来的应收账款出售给金融机构,以换取即期现金。这种方式帮助出口商解决了资金流动问题,并将信用风险转移给了金融机构。 福费廷的类型包括贴现福费廷(discount forfaiting)、无追索权福费廷(without recourse forfaiting)、有追索权福费廷(with recourse forfaiting)、固定利率福费廷(fixed-rate forfaiting),以及浮动利率福费廷(floating-rate forfaiting)。本文我们将探讨福费廷的好处和流程。
